PRIORITY SECTORS

 

The bank’s priority sectors are:-

Agriculture
Agriculture is considered the cornerstone of  Zambia's economic development. The Bank will aim to support various agricultural activities especially those involving the production of high value exportable crops as a way of enhancing foreign currency earning and those which support locally developed agricultural processing and creates employment opportunities.

Processing Industry
The Bank will support agro processing, mineral and wood processing industries.
 

Manufacturing
The Bank will support manufacturing enterprises promoting employment opportunities and particularly those in which Zambia has comparative advantage in the region in order to enhance Zambia's exports into COMESA and SADC regional markets.

Tourism
Tourism is potentially the fastest growing sector with the capacity to earn the country foreign exchange and contribute to substantial employment generation . There exists a huge untapped potential in tourism which needs to be supported through additional infrastructure, construction of lodges and motels and production artifacts.
 

Transport and Haulage
Zambia is a landlocked country and hence is highly dependant on haulage network for its imports and exports. This sector forms an important element in the development process.

Fisheries

The country has abundant natural resources in terms of lakes and rivers in which breed reserves of various species of  fish and conducive environment for the development of fish farming targeting the local and regional market.  Fish processing is an industry which has remained untapped and yet is a source of national income, contributor to food security and  generation of employment.

 

Infrastructure

The Bank will support infrastructure projects in telecommunications, road and dam construction, irrigation, airports, power stations etc
